摘要:
A method for comparing text data reads two patent documents comprising varying text sections. The method compares characters of a first text section in a first patent document with a corresponding second text section in a second patent document, and acquires a same sub-character string that has a maximum matching length and matching positions of the first and second text sections. The method marks characters before the matching positions of the first and second text sections as different characters. The method displays a comparison result list of the comparison between the first patent document and the second patent document on a display device.
摘要:
A computing device extracts claims, patent law clauses, and prior art documents from an Office action document according to preset regular expressions, and stores the extracted claims, patent law clauses, and prior art documents in an array stored in a storage unit of the computing device. The computing device identifies rejected claims of the Office action document from the extracted claims, and searches involved patent law clauses and prior art documents regarding the rejected claims in the Office action document. The computing device records each identified rejected claim with involved patent law clauses and prior art documents in the storage unit, according to importance ratings of the rejected claims and the relationships.
摘要:
A server generates a first ID in response to a user inputting a username on a web portal provided by the server. If the user selects a link page displayed through the web portal, the server generates a second ID and sends the first ID and the second ID to the selected link page. The server detects if the user can access the selected link page by reference to the first ID and the second ID. If the server verifies the information successfully, the link page may be entered using the portal information.
摘要:
In a method for analyzing an office action of a patent application using a computing device, an office action of a patent application that is downloaded from a patent office website is parsed using predetermined regular expressions (RE). The patent information of patent application is extracted from the office action according to predetermined keywords of the patent information if the office action fails to be parsed by the regular expressions. A regular expression of the extracted patent information is generated according to determined rules, and is stored into the storage system, to parse another office action using the generated regular expression.
摘要:
In a method for processing an image file using a computing device, an image file from a storage system is read. If an image in the image file is slanted, an incision coordinates according to a configuration file in the storage system and a preset formula is calculated. The method incises the image using the calculated incision coordinates and storing the incised image in a new image file. If an image in the new image file is not slanted, the method further determines whether the image has been incised. If the image has been incised, the method records the calculated incision coordinates that make the image not be slanted as optimal incision coordinates, and stores the optimal incision coordinates into a database.
摘要:
A system and method for analyzing official notices of an electronically filed patent application are based on a file server that connects to patent office websites, a database, and client computers. An official notice of the patent application is downloaded from one of the patent office websites according to a download command from one of the client computers, and is converted to an image format document. Character data of the image format document are identified, and patent information of the electronically filed patent application are extracted from the character data using a regular expression. In addition, the patent information are analyzed to generate analysis results of the official notice according to the comparison.
摘要:
A system for creating full-text indexes of patent documents includes a server and one or more computers. The server is connected with the one or more computers via a network. The server includes: a converting module is configured for converting the new patent document into a file in a predefined format, the file comprising multi-parts each corresponding to a part of the patent document; and a creating module is configured for appending the converted patent document to the database with a technique of creating full-text indexes and creating a full-text index for each part of all converted patent documents in the database. The method for creating full-text indexes of patent documents is also disclosed.
摘要:
A method for managing receipts of an e-filing patent application is disclosed. The method includes: receiving one or more receipts from a patent office website via the Internet when a patent application is filed in the patent office electronically; uploading the one or more receipts to a file server; obtaining information corresponding to keywords of the one or more receipts; and updating information of the patent application in a database server connected to the file server according to the information corresponding to the keywords. A related system is also disclosed.
摘要:
A computer-based method for creating XML files from an edited document is disclosed. The method includes the steps of: reading an edited document from a file transfer protocol (FTP) server; reading each of equation objects originally existed in the edited file and creating a tag image file (TIF) image according to the equation object being read; creating a joint photographic experts group (JPEG) image according to the TIF image and recording a pixel size of the JPEG image; creating an XML character string according to each paragraph in the edited file; inserting the XML character strings into different XML file templates, thereby obtaining different XML files. A related system is also disclosed.
摘要:
A computer-based method for evaluating patents is provided. The method includes the steps of: obtaining patents to be evaluated from a database server according to a predetermined patents evaluating date; assigning one or more undertakers to evaluate the patents; gathering basic information of the patents from the database server; providing the undertakers with evaluation parameters of each patent according to the basic information of the patents; submitting evaluation opinions made by the undertakers to relevant patents owners; and receiving evaluation decisions made by the patents owners and sending the evaluation decisions to the undertakers. A related system is also disclosed.